Find it in the sky

  • How to spot it. At magnitude 7.9 it is just past naked-eye reach — ordinary binoculars will pull it in, over in Musca.
  • Southern sky only. So far south it never rises for most of the northern hemisphere. To see it you'd have to travel to Chile, South Africa or Australia.
  • Best time of year. It stands highest in the middle of the night around March — that's when to go looking.

Its true colour

  • Its true colour. Measured through blue and visual filters it comes out deep orange-red (B−V 1.7) — one of the coolest surfaces a star can have while still fusing.

By the numbers

  • Surface temperature. Its colour puts the surface at roughly 3580 K, against the Sun's 5778 K.

What's in a name

  • Its catalogue. The HD number is from the Henry Draper Catalogue, in which Annie Jump Cannon personally classified the spectra of nearly 400,000 stars — still the largest such feat by one person.
